      He'll get back and he'll be back 100% IF his mind allows him to be. The injury itself is fixed, he'll rehab and it will be strengthened to the point that it will be fine mechanically, but he'll have to allow himself to believe it won't be a problem. So the biggest thing will be can he play with the same fire and determination to get stuck in that he always did. Will he make those long runs and then stop on a dime and trust his knee. That's going to be the question. He has no business trying to make it back for this season though. He's young enough that there's no reason whatsoever to rush him because a full recovery can mean his career can still be a long, healthy one.

      Reports now saying it's worse than first feared....

      Clickbait tweet if it's the same one you saw. There's probably damage to the MCL or LCL too which won't really affect the surgery or recovery timeline. Could be meniscus as well but again, that would be fixed within the timeline of the ACL. Pretty sure Ox's knee was torn apart worse than Virgil's and we know how long his recovery took. I'd say expect Virgil to be out about a year. Maybe 18 months to be back to his 7 days ago self, full fitness.
